What's the deal in Business?
Over 50 of our Year 11 Business Management Students were inspired today after hearing from an enthusiastic entrepreneur, Sam Watherston from Just Blend, as he shared his experiences of his 18 month journey bringing his fruity vision into fruition. Just Blend, a Tauranga based business, produces and markets convenient, wholesome, balanced, proportioned smoothies pouches. Sam’s passion and uptake to deliver healthy choices to the NZ market was evident throughout the educational presentation. Information gained from Just Blend will give the students a context to base their business concepts on, in the upcoming NCEA examinations.
Business Management Students Trip to Sanford
Year 13 Otumoetai College Business Management students had the opportunity to visit Sanford, a business operating in a global context. Steve Keeves, Operations Manager of Sanford spent time speaking to the students about innovation, IP, change management, quality control, and external factors influencing the business in a global market. They were given a tour around the business to view many areas of the company to gain an understanding of the operations and size of the Tauranga branch.
This experience creates a wonderful connection between the course that they are doing and the real hands-on world of business. Students quoted “I have come away with a better understanding of the topics we have studied, putting them in context with the business will allow me to easily remember each topic for the examinations”. These field trips have proved invaluable in preparing the students involved to achieve success in their studies. We thank Steve Keeves for his ongoing support.
